Performance of Top Carpooling and Ridesharing Apps in Italy, Q1 2025
Explore the growth trends of leading carpooling and ridesharing apps in Italy during Q1 2025, with insights from Sensor Tower.
During the first quarter of 2025, the carpooling and ridesharing sector in Italy showed diverse trends across the top apps on a unified platform. Data from Sensor Tower reveals intriguing patterns in weekly downloads and active users for these leading applications.
Uber - Request a ride maintained strong performance with a notable increase in weekly downloads from 25.7K at the start of January to 33K by the end of March. The number of weekly active users also showed an upward trend, growing from 257K to 365K over the quarter.
Bolt: Request a Ride experienced a gradual rise in downloads, starting at 13.2K and peaking at 17.5K mid-March. Active users displayed stability with a slight increase, ending the quarter at approximately 156K.
Grab: Taxi Ride, Food Delivery showed a decline in weekly downloads from 5.5K to 2.3K. However, the active user base remained relatively stable, fluctuating around 170K throughout the quarter.
inDrive. Save on city rides saw a slight decrease in downloads from 4.1K to 3.1K by the end of March. Weekly active users hovered around 11K, reflecting steady engagement.
Finally, BlaBlaCar: Carpooling and Bus experienced a minor fluctuation in downloads, starting at 3.8K and ending at 3.4K. Active users showed a similar pattern, with numbers stabilizing around 96K towards the end of the quarter.
